[RECAP] Anjunadeep Open Air at the Brooklyn Mirage in New York

| July 28, 2019

Anjundeep did it again with another spectacular event, Anjunadeep Open Air at the Brooklyn Mirage in New York. 

As always this magical outdoor theater was the perfect setting for Anjuna's uplifting dance beats. 

The sunset over the stage with a silhouette of Manhattan in the background was one of the most beautiful sights of all summer. Summer goes by fast, but it's moments like these that give us those unforgettable summer nights memories. The vibes were incredible and everyone on the dance floor radiated positive energy. 

The Brooklyn Mirage feels like a castle, except with fog and lasers creating one of the most unbelievable dance floors to be a part of.  

 

The music went from 6pm all the way until the wee hours of 4am. In the city that never sleeps, of course the dance floor was still packed at 4am. Some standout sets were from Elle & Fur, Jodie Wisternoff & James Grant. The curation of the music was perfect - a night of getting lost in dancing Anjunadeep's music is like therapy for the soul. a
